A wonderful comedy thriller that, although directed by Stanley Donen, has a definite flavour of Alfred Hitchcock about it. Charade's plot concerns a woman who finds her husband dead and is then pursued by four men who are convinced that she has access to a large sum of money - with her only ally a handsome young stranger. Featuring ravishing Parisian locations and the dream double-casting of stars Audrey Hepburn and Cary Grant, this is an unadulterated delight.
